EXECUTIVE ORDER NO. 20 SERIES OF 2020
WHEREAS, on March 12, 2020 the Inter-Agency Task Force for the Management of
Emerging Infectious Disease (IATF-EID) per Resolution No. 11, Series of 2020, raised the COVID-19
threat to the highest alert level, Code Red Sublevel 2, due to the evidence of sustained transmission
of the disease. Concomitantly, President Rodrigo Roa Duterte approved the recommendation to
place the entire Luzon in Enhanced Community Quarantine.
WHEREAS, the Bayanihan to Heal as One Act empowers the national government to
provide and emergency subsidy to eighteen (18) million low-income families through the DILG-
DBM-DOLE-DSWD-DA-DTI-DOF Joint Memorandum Circular No. 1 series of 2020 providing the
guidelines for the Social Amelioration Program (SAP). In Region IV-A, a maximum amount of six
thousand five hundred pesos (PhP 6,500.00) a month for two months shall be provided to low-
income families to provide basic food, medicine and toiletries.
WHEREAS, an integral part of the SAP Program is the distribution of the Social
Amelioration Card (SAC) which is a form distributed at the barangay level that captures the family
profile which will be the mechanism for the affected families to access the Social Amelioration
Programs of the government;
WHEREAS, the local government units and the barangays are in the forefront of this
program to provide assistance to the IATF in the efficient implementation of the Social
Amelioration Program:
